Welcome Reggie Serafin, our new Executive Chef The Lilac Inn is pleased to announce that Reggie Serafin has been hired as Executive Chef. We wanted to find a chef that shares our appreciation of local Vermont products and our passion for great food and who could create enticing seasonal menus that appeal to Vermonters and guests of the Inn. Reggie was the Executive Chef at the Red Clover Inn of Mendon, VT for two years and most recently an Executive chef in Killington, VT. He is a graduate of the New England Culinary Institute and the 2007 winner of Jack Daniel’s Tennessee cook off, as well as, local awards.

The Lilac Inn, Brandon, Vermont is proud to be an active member of the Vermont Fresh Network. We are in a partnership with a half dozen Vermont Farmers and Food Producers serving only the freshest, native ingredients whenever possible. |
